Output 2f29968cbe7e2b76bf0c30fb0225ed5cb2888fc92d23efa66814a146d91fb15c:3

value
21587816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fe212b67293503ae0c79479c5b083dcc19f7f1 OP_EQUAL
address
MAztxzXF2udkkqiMjR7xx3vKjeF5Vq8e65
transaction
2f29968cbe7e2b76bf0c30fb0225ed5cb2888fc92d23efa66814a146d91fb15c
spent
true